Have you tried their sanctuary setup? I ran the sanctuary jacket and sanctuary bibs with their furnace long john top and bottom and a grid fleece underneath this season in Northern Minnesota.

An early cold snap came through and we saw temps in the -10 to -20 range with wind chill. There were some afternoons with 15-20 mph winds. I was plenty warm all day in the tree with that system and proper head/face coverage.
